What is the cost of living in Mound, MN?

According to the most recent data on the cost of living, Mound has an overall cost of living index of 109, which is 1.1x higher than the national index of 100.

Compared to Minnesota, Mound has a cost of living index that's 1.1x higher than Minnesota's index of 101.

The standard of living in Mound ranks as #86 most affordable out of the 151 places we measured in Minnesota. By definition, that implies Mound ranks as the #65 most expensive place in the North Star State.

Mound Cost Of Living Vs. Minnesota

Six factors go into calculating the cost of living index in Mound. Here is how it fares on each of the criteria:

  • The Services index in Mound is 101.

  • The Groceries index in Mound is 98.

  • The Health index in Mound is 126.

  • The Housing index in Mound is 102.

  • The Transportation index in Mound is 108.

  • The Utilities index in Mound is 97.

Living Expense Mound Minnesota National Average
Overall 109 101 100
Services 101 101 100
Groceries 98 99 100
Health 126 99 100
Housing 102 101 100
Transportation 108 103 100
Utilities 97 101 100

Mound, MN Housing Cost Breakdown

$378,826Median Home Value
$1,098Median Rent
$86,675Median Income

Housing swings affordability the most between places in Minnesota, so we broke down housing costs into more detail. Home and income data comes from the most recent US Census ACS 2020-2024. The key points are:

  • The Median Home Value in Mound is $378,826.

  • The Median Rent in Mound is $1,098.

  • The Median Income in Mound is $86,675.

  • The Home Value To Income in Mound is 4.4x.

  • The Rent To Monthly Income in Mound is 0.15x.

Statistic Mound Minnesota United States
Median Home Value $378,826 $346,667 $332,700
Median Rent $1,098 $1,280 $1,413
Median Income $86,675 $89,062 $80,734
Home Value To Income 4.4x 3.9x 4.1x
Rent To Monthly Income 0.15x 0.17x 0.21x
